3.3 VOLT HIGH-DENSITY SUPERSYNC II™
NARROW BUS FIFO
512 x 18/1,024 x 9, 1,024 x 18/2,048 x 9
2,048 x 18/4,096 x 9, 4,096 x 18/8,192 x 9
8,192 x 18/16,384 x 9, 16,384 x 18/32,768 x 9
32,768 x 18/65,536 x 9, 65,536 x 18/131,072 x 9
IDT72V223, IDT72V233
IDT72V243, IDT72V253
IDT72V263, IDT72V273
IDT72V283, IDT72V293
FEATURES:
• Choose among the following memory organizations:
IDT72V223  512 x 18/1,024 x 9
IDT72V233  1,024 x 18/2,048 x 9
IDT72V243  2,048 x 18/4,096 x 9
IDT72V253  4,096 x 18/8,192 x 9
IDT72V263  8,192 x 18/16,384 x 9
IDT72V273  16,384 x 18/32,768 x 9
IDT72V283  32,768 x 18/65,536 x 9
IDT72V293  65,536 x 18/131,072 x 9
• Functionally compatible with the IDT72V255LA/72V265LA and
IDT72V275/72V285 SuperSync FIFOs
• Up to 166 MHz Operation of the Clocks
• User selectable Asynchronous read and/or write ports (BGA Only)
• User selectable input and output port bus-sizing
- x9 in to x9 out
- x9 in to x18 out
- x18 in to x9 out
- x18 in to x18 out
• Pin to Pin compatible to the higher density of IDT72V2103/72V2113
• Big-Endian/Little-Endian user selectable byte representation
• 5V tolerant inputs
• Fixed, low first word latency
• Zero latency retransmit
• Auto power down minimizes standby power consumption
• Master Reset clears entire FIFO
• Partial Reset clears data, but retains programmable settings
• Empty, Full and Half-Full flags signal FIFO status
• Programmable Almost-Empty and Almost-Full flags, each flag can
default to one of eight preselected offsets
• Selectable synchronous/asynchronous timing modes for Almost-
Empty and Almost-Full flags
• Program programmable flags by either serial or parallel means
• Select IDT Standard timing (using EF and FF flags) or First Word
Fall Through timing (using OR and IR flags)
• Output enable puts data outputs into high impedance state
• Easily expandable in depth and width
• JTAG port, provided for Boundary Scan function (BGA Only)
• Independent Read and Write Clocks (permit reading and writing
simultaneously)
• Available in a 80-pin Thin Quad Flat Pack (TQFP) or a 100-pin Ball
Grid Array (BGA) (with additional features)
• High-performance submicron CMOS technology
• Industrial temperature range (–40°C to +85°C) is available
